Zelenskyy: Ukrainian Armed Forces hold back 64 thousand Russians in Kursk region

5 April 2025 02:17

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y said that Russia has concentrated 64,000 of its soldiers in the Kursk region. The head of state said this during a briefing, "Komersant Ukrainian" reports

“This is a very serious grouping that could spread and attack us from other directions along the entire front line,” Zelensky said.

He praised the Ukrainian military for holding back the Russians and reiterated that there is no encirclement in this area.

“We are on the territory of the Kursk region, and not only on the territory of the Kursk region, by the way,” the head of state said, without providing details.

The General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ine reported on April 4 that Ukrainian defenders repelled seven Russian attacks in the Kursk region. In this area, Russian troops conducted three air strikes, dropping five guided bombs and firing 211 artillery rounds. As of 16:00, fighting continued in two locations.

The day before, on April 3, the president visited the command posts of the 36th separate marine brigade and the 82nd separate air assault brigade in Sumy region and awarded Ukrainian soldiers.
